Boca Juniors secured their place in the semifinals of the Closing Tournament by winning 1-0 against Argentinos Juniors in the stadium Alberto J. Armando (La Bombonera)with a goal Ayrton Costa in the first minutes of the game. The team led by Claudio Ubeda He added his sixth consecutive victory and established himself as a serious candidate for the title. Now, Boca Juniors wait for the winner of the cross between Racing y Tigre to meet their next rival in the semifinals.
During the meeting, Agustín Marchesín was key in avoiding a tie on several occasions, standing out with saves against shots from Diego Porcel y Alan Lescano. In the second half, Tomas Molina He came close to equalizing the score with a header that passed very close to the goal defended by Marchesín.
